5. Find mTOS in the figure below.
Vikentia [17]

Applying the definition of a linear pair, m∠TOS = 52°

<em>Recall:</em>

Linear pair are two angles on a straight line whose sum equals 180°.

Given:

  • m∠TOU = 128°
  • m∠SOV = (4x + 8)°

m∠TOU + m∠TOS = 180° (linear pair)

  • Substitute

128° + m∠TOS =  180°

  • Subtract 128° from both sides of the equation

m∠TOS = 180° - 128°

m∠TOS = 52°

Thus, applying the definition of linear pair, m∠TOS = 52°

Help i need the answer by 10am December 23
Sever21 [200]

Answer:

Simon:         55     hours

Alvin:           70     hours

Theodore:  <u>159</u>   hours

Total:         284  hours

Step-by-step explanation:

Let A, T, and S stand for the hours worked by Alvin, Simon, and Theodore.

We are told that:

A = S + 15,

T = 3S - 6

and

A + S + T = 284

Note that the first two equations state the value of A and T in terms of S.  Let's use them in the third equation, so that we'll have only one unknow:

A + S + T = 284

(S + 15) + S + (3S - 6) = 284

5S + 9 = 284

<em><u>S = 55</u></em>

Now use this value of S in the first two equations to find A and T:

A = S + 15

A = 55 + 15

<u><em>A = 70</em></u>

T = 3S - 6

T = 3*55 - 6

<em><u>T = 159</u></em>

<u></u>

<u>(55 + 70 + 159) = 284</u>
